MySQL学习笔记之二:数据库和表基本操作

时间:2022-06-20 14:06:58

MySQL学习笔记之二:数据库和表基本操作

李小艺】2014-03-31

操作MySQL数据库

【创建数据库】

CREATE DATABASE数据库名;

【显示数据库信息】

SHOW DATABASES;

【删除数据库】

DROP DATABASE 数据库名;

【查看数据库存储引擎】

SHOW ENGINES;

 

操作MySQL

【创建表】

CREATE TABLE exampleid INT,

                               Name VARCHAR(20),

                                Sex BOOLEAN);

【显示表格详情】

DESC  表名;

SHOW CREATE TABLE表名;

 

【设置表的主键】

CREATE TABLE example(stu_id INTPRIMARY KEY,

               Stu_name VARCHAR(20) NOT NULL,

               Sex VARCHAR(2) );

【多字段主键】

CREATE TABLE example(stu_id INT,

               Course_id  INT,

               Grade FLOAT,

              PRIMARY KEY(stu_id, course_id) );

【修改表名】

ALTER   TABLE   example  RENAME  user;

【修改字段的数据类型】

ALTER   TABLE  user  MODIFY  name  VARCHAR(30);

【修改字段名】

ALTER  TABLE  user  CHANGE  stu_name   name   VARCHAR(20);

【增加字段】

ALTER  TABLE  user  ADD  phone   VARCHAR(20);

【在表的第一个位置增加字段】

ALTER  TABLE  user  ADD  num  INT(8)  PRIMARY KEY  FIRST;

【在某个字段之后增加一个字段】

ALTERT TABLE user  ADD  address  VARCHAR(30)   AFTER  phone;

【删除字段】

ALTER  TABLE  表名  DROP  字段名;

【删除表】

DROP  TABLE  表名;